Former Strictly Come Dancing stars James and Ola Jordan have disclosed that their little daughter Ella was taken to A&E with a ‘very high temperature’.
Celebrity Big Brother star James, who participated on Strictly from 2006 to 2013, and Ola, who appeared on the BBC One programme from 2006 to 2015, received an outpouring of sympathy after tweeting photos of their three-year-old in a hospital bed, updating fans on her health concerns.
He wrote: ‘My little warrior!! We are still at Pembury Hospital but she has finally turned a corner after 5 days and long nights of fighting an extremely high temperature.
‘It started Monday but on Wednesday night things got pretty bad and temperature was 40+ so took her to A and E at roughly midnight. Where a doctor gave her a quick look over and said it was a viral infection and told us to continue with Calpol/Ibuprofen and take her home and it would take its course.
‘I did try to say it seems more like a chest infection than a viral infection but I’m not the expert. He also told us that it wasn’t because he had listened to her chest.
‘After getting her home we kept a log of every time we gave her Calpol and then Ibuprofen (2 hours apart) alternating. After 2 more terrible nights of her temperature staying around 39 – 40 and her throwing up several times in her sleep. And even though we felt we were maybe wasting the doctors and nurses time and would look like overprotective parents – we decided to take her back to A and E.’
After returning to the hospital, James stated that they had a “completely different experience.”
He penned: ‘What a totally different experience – we were met by caring and fun nurses who were 100% attentive and by a doctor that was so thorough and taking nothing to chance.
‘Ella clearly looked not well and was sent straight to X Ray – and almost immediately had bloods taken by a totally amazing team of nurses. Who I thank massively .’
Ella was diagnosed with a lung infection and tonsillitis, and she was placed on an IV drip for medication since she was “very ill.”
James concluded: ‘Anyway, the moral of the story is – go with your gut parents. We knew it was something more serious. I’m just angry with myself I didn’t push harder. But to be honest I didn’t want to be a d**k to them.
‘It’s just a shame sometimes you have to because of some people’s incompetence. Then on the flip side, today we experienced the opposite end of the spectrum by sheer brilliance from a wonderful team of people.
‘This post might go down like a lead balloon for me to even dare say anything negative about the NHS. But I will do anything for my baby girl.’
